## US UV Adhesives Market Overview

The demand for UV adhesives in the United States is experiencing a significant upswing, driven by their versatility and superior performance characteristics in various industries. The following key points outline the factors influencing the demand dynamics of the US UV adhesives market: Growing Manufacturing Sector: The expansion of the manufacturing sector in the US is a primary driver of UV adhesives demand. These adhesives are widely used in manufacturing processes for bonding, joining, and assembling components across diverse industries such as electronics, automotive, and medical devices.

Rising Importance in Electronics: UV adhesives play a crucial role in the electronics industry, especially in the assembly of electronic components. Their ability to provide rapid curing, precise bonding, and resistance to temperature variations makes them essential for the production of electronic devices and circuitry. Advancements in Medical Device Manufacturing: The medical device industry increasingly relies on UV adhesives for assembling and bonding medical devices. UV adhesives offer biocompatibility, rapid curing, and the ability to bond a variety of materials, meeting the stringent requirements of medical applications.

Optical and Display Technologies: UV adhesives find extensive use in optical and display technologies, including the manufacturing of lenses, touchscreens, and display panels. Their optical clarity, fast curing time, and durability make them ideal for applications where transparency and precision are crucial. Automotive Assembly Applications: UV adhesives are employed in the automotive industry for various assembly applications, including bonding interior components, attaching trim elements, and joining electronic components. Their ability to provide strong bonds without the need for extended curing times contributes to efficiency in automotive manufacturing.

Enhanced Environmental Performance: UV adhesives are considered environmentally friendly as they typically contain fewer volatile organic compounds (VOCs) compared to traditional adhesives. This aligns with the increasing focus on sustainable and eco-friendly manufacturing practices, driving the adoption of UV adhesives. Efficient Production Processes: The rapid curing properties of UV adhesives significantly contribute to efficient production processes. Manufacturers benefit from shortened assembly times, increased production speeds, and reduced energy consumption, leading to cost savings and improved overall efficiency.

Increasing Applications in Packaging: UV adhesives are gaining traction in the packaging industry due to their ability to provide secure and fast bonding for various packaging materials. This includes applications such as labeling, sealing, and bonding packaging components, enhancing the overall efficiency of packaging operations. Customization and Formulation Innovations: The ability to customize UV adhesives for specific applications and the continuous innovation in formulation contribute to their growing demand. Manufacturers can tailor UV adhesives to meet specific bonding requirements, expanding their applicability across diverse industries.

Adoption of UV LED Technology: The increasing adoption of UV LED technology is influencing the demand for UV adhesives. UV LED curing systems offer advantages such as energy efficiency, longer life, and precise control over the curing process, further enhancing the appeal of UV adhesives in various applications. Expanding Renewable Energy Sector: UV adhesives play a role in the renewable energy sector, particularly in the manufacturing of solar panels. Their ability to bond materials used in solar cell production, coupled with efficient curing, contributes to the growth of UV adhesives in this expanding industry.

Stringent Quality and Regulatory Standards: UV adhesives meet stringent quality and regulatory standards, making them a preferred choice in industries with strict compliance requirements. This includes applications in aerospace, medical, and electronics where adherence to quality standards is paramount.

Single Component (Dominant) vs. Two Component (Emerging)

Single Component UV adhesives are recognized for their simplicity and versatility, making them the dominant choice for many manufacturers. These adhesives cure quickly upon exposure to UV light, ensuring efficient production timelines. Conversely, Two Component UV adhesives consist of a resin and hardener that must be mixed prior to application, providing enhanced strength and durability. Their growing popularity is driven by increasing demands for high-performance bonding solutions in sectors such as automotive and electronics, positioning them as an emerging choice for precision applications.
